The deubiquitinating enzyme 3 pseudogene (ENSG00000254923; LOC392196) is a non-protein-coding sequence in the human genome, bearing similarity to deubiquitinating enzymes but lacking enzymatic activity or established biological function[5]. Deubiquitinating enzymes (DUBs) are a family of proteases that remove ubiquitin from proteins and have major roles in regulating protein degradation, cell signaling, DNA repair, and epigenetic modification[1][2][4]. However, pseudogenes such as this one do not code for a functional enzyme and thus do not carry out these molecular functions nor serve as current therapeutic targets. The naming of this pseudogene reflects historical sequence similarity to active DUB gene family members (such as ubiquitin C-terminal hydrolases or ubiquitin-specific peptidases) but should not be confused with functional proteins of the DUB superfamily[5].
